Latest Govt filing in the Ghislaine Maxwell case makes the DOJ/FBI look really bad -

Ghislaine was hit with new charges of sex trafficking of a minor on 3/29/21.

The Govt had previously interviewed this victim back in 2007.

They knew this entire time.

Ghislaine Maxwell moves for a continuance of the July 12 trial date.

Argument: new charges require more investigation.

Needs more time to review newly produced "20,000 pages of interview notes" and 2,100 "Highly Confidential" photos.
